BILL Reports Third Quarter Fiscal Year 2026 Financial Results and Announces $1.0 Billion Share Repurchase Authorization
May 7, 2026 4:01 PM EDTQ3 Core Revenue Increased 16% Year-Over-Year Q3 Total Revenue Increased 13% Year-Over-Year
SAN JOSE,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- BILL (NYSE: BILL), the financial operations platform trusted by nearly half a million businesses to manage, move, and maximize their money, today announced financial results for the third fiscal quarter ended March 31, 2026.
